Ticket #4471 — Cleaning Crew Access, Harwick Tower

The evening cleaning crew from Brightmere Services will start on the 4th floor this week instead of the 2nd. Team assistants should make sure meeting rooms are cleared by 18:30 so the crew isn't delayed. The crew lead will check in at the east stairwell door each evening. The temporary pass code for that door is below.

turnstile pass: bdg-QZV-3

Handover note: The restock planner for the Snackline vending fleet runs nightly and outputs route sheets per machine cluster. Config lives in the planner-config repo; tweak bin thresholds there, not in code. Deploys go through the usual Fernwick pipeline. If a route looks wrong, check stale inventory feeds first. Questions about the planner go to the current owner:

account owner for bawip-tahag: Raleth Quenok

## Step 4: Repoint GraphScope to the new renderer

GraphScope, our dependency graph visualizer, no longer reads layout settings from the legacy bundle. After upgrading to the Marigold release, the edge-routing engine expects all values in the unified config store. Delete the old `layout.toml` before restarting, or the daemon will merge stale keys and produce overlapping clusters. Once the store is clean, apply the settings exactly as shown below.

config for hahip-kaguf:
[holath]
port = 8443
region = north-4
host = holath.tolvaqlabs.internal
timeout_ms = 1000
retries = 2

### TICKET-4417: Crash-report pipeline sign-off needed

The Fennel mobile crash-report pipeline now strips device fingerprints before storage and batches uploads hourly instead of per-event. Symbolication moved to the new worker pool; old pool decommissioned next sprint. Future maintainers: do not re-enable per-event uploads — it melted the ingest tier once already. Deploy is blocked pending sign-off from the owner named below.

named custodian: Oliath Ralax